When working with Python, we often need to use a lot of third-party libraries. For example, the Pillow mentioned above, as well as the MySQL driver, the web framework Flask, the scientific calculation module Numpy, and so on.

A third party module is any code that has been written by a third party (neither you nor the python writers (PSF)). You can use them to add functionality to your code without having to write it yourself. Examples include things like requests that simplifies http requests and nose that helps with unit/integration testing.
